2600 Jewellery To Compliment Saree Colours Undoubtedly colours play an essential role when you go to accessories your saree. For warm colour sarees, golden jewellery will be a good choice. For cool colour sarees silver, diamond, white stone jewellery will be perfect. Warm colours are Red, Yellow, Orange, Maroon.

Tips for Selecting the Right Saree Jewellery. Consider the Neckline: Choose necklaces and pendants that complement the saree blouse neckline. Match with Saree Color: Coordinate the jewelry metal and color with the saree for a harmonious look. Balance the Look: Pair heavy necklaces with simple earrings or vice versa to create balance.
